Do any of you have granite floor tiles?

6 replies

mumhadenough · 20/01/2010 22:02

We're just about to lay white granite floor tiles with sparkly bits in on the bathroom floor. I was just wondering, do you have spaces with grout in between them or are they closely fitted together.

DH is an ace tiler, but has never laid granite before.

Mr Rollmops here,

Lay them just like tiles but be mindful of cutting them. DH will need a fairly serious piece of kit to cut them. This is best done in the garden with nothing (house, washing etc.) downwind as the dust is pretty impressive.

I thoroughly recommend underfloor heating as there is no greater luxury (that I can write here than walking barefoot on a warm floor on a winter morning. There are kits on ebay for a couple of hundred quid and you can't change your mind about it later.

Just to add... we've just had granite floor tiles fitted in our kitchen. I noticed that the Tiler used normal 'spacers' (as you would on wall tiles) and then he grouted as per usual.

It looks really good....
